We lost 45 big round bales out of the field a couple years ago. The thief even used our tractor after he broke the lock off the shed to get in. Turned out to be a local dairy farmer that to this day denies that he was in the wrong. He showed the Sheriff a cancelled check from 9 years ago made out to my since deceased Uncle for hay. Claims he was buying "hay futures". I ended up getting $25 use for the tractor...nothing for the hay!
